The long-awaited follow-up to last year’s popular Netflix thriller “Hasseen Dillruba” is preparing to shock viewers once more. The trailer for “Phir Aayi Hasseen Dillruba” has been unveiled, offering a captivating mix of suspenseful neo-noir and nostalgic Bollywood elements. Starring Taapsee Pannu, Vikrant Massey, and some fresh faces, this film is definitely worth keeping an eye on.

Phir Aayi Hasseen Dillruba cast: Who are the actors?

The long-awaited trailer for Phir Aayi Hasseen Dillruba has been released, and fans of the initial film are now buzzing with anticipation. This sequel promises to keep viewers hooked in the same thrilling way as its predecessor, which garnered significant acclaim on the streaming platform.

In the next chapter, Rani (Taapsee Pannu) and her husband Rishu (Vikrant Massey), whom we meet again, face fresh challenges as their past scandal lingers on. A new character, Abhimanyu (Sunny Kaushal), enters the scene, adding another obstacle to their already complicated lives.

The trailer begins with Rani proudly recounting the extreme measures she and Rishu took for their love, as she had always planned. As they leave their past behind and focus on their future, Rishu sets a rule: their relationship must be monogamous, with no outside interference. However, this arrangement is put to the test when a new romantic interest emerges. It’s important to note that it was Rani’s infidelity with Neel Tripathi, Rishu’s cousin, that led them to this point.

In the trailer for “As Phir Aayi Hasseen Dillruba,” Vikrant Massey’s character continues his destructive behavior towards Rani and her new lover, Abhimanyu. But there’s a twist: he may not stop there and could harm Rani as well. Furthermore, Jimmy Shergill joins the cast as Officer Mritunjay, who is revealed to be Neel’s maternal uncle and seems to add to the antagonistic forces at play.

In summary, as Rani eloquently states, “Love that doesn’t drive you to the edge of madness isn’t real love. Those who crave passionless relationships are the timid ones.” Regarding the upcoming release, Phir Aayi Hasseen Dillruba will be available on Netflix starting August 9, 2024.
